The Wisdom of Giving Thanks ? 1977

The Wisdom of Giving Thanks ? 1977

Pastor Jack draws from Psalm 122 and current events in the Middle East to explore the wisdom of giving thanks and intercessory prayer. In this Thanksgiving Eve service from 1977, he examines the prophetic significance of Egyptian President Anwar Sadat's historic visit to Jerusalem, calling believers to pray strategically for peace in the region, for the United States to stand firm with Israel, and for discernment as prophetic events unfold. The message culminates in worship and prayer ministry, emphasizing that thanksgiving keeps people spiritually "straight" and aligned with God's purposes.
The Breastplate of Righteousness

The Breastplate of Righteousness

Pastor Jack teaches from Ephesians 6 on the breastplate of righteousness as part of the believer's spiritual armor. He explains that righteousness is not about our own performance or good deeds, but rather Christ's righteousness attributed to us through faith. Drawing on the imagery of Roman armor, Pastor Jack shows how worship and understanding God's love form the foundation for effective spiritual warfare, enabling believers to stand confidently against the enemy's accusations and bring God's rightness into wrong situations through prayer.

Freedom From Fear

Freedom From Fear

Pastor Jack draws from the list of common bondage points he introduced in a previous session and reveals how nearly all of them trace back to a single root: fear. Using Proverbs 29:25 as his foundation, he teaches that the fear of man brings a snare, but those who trust in the Lord will be safe. He explores the nature of fear, its many expressions?from defensiveness to withdrawal?and shows how imperfect authority figures in our past create patterns of fear. Pastor Jack emphasizes that God is our "boethos," the One who comes running when we cry for help, and that perfect love expressed through praying in the Spirit will erode the roots of fear and bring freedom.
